Hello, This confirms your scheduled visit to the Penwright Hosting data centre, cage row D, on Thursday morning. Please arrive at the main gatehouse fifteen minutes early so security can verify your work order and issue a temporary lanyard. Tools must be declared at the gatehouse and bagged equipment will be inspected. Your escort from our operations team will meet you at the cage door. To pass through the inner mantrap, enter the code below.

turnstile pass: bdg-FVNQRS-72965873

## Runbook: Passage reset flow revamp

The revamped Passage password reset flow replaces emailed links with short-lived codes and rate-limits by account rather than IP. Cut-over is feature-flagged; enable per-tenant, largest tenants last. Watch reset success rate on the Ferndale dashboard — below 85% for ten minutes means roll the flag back, no approval needed. Old tokens stay valid for 48 hours post-cut-over. The flow service ships with the following configuration.

service settings:
PRAIX_LOG_LEVEL=error
PRAIX_METRICS_HOST=metrics.praix.qorvelcorp.corp
PRAIX_POOL_SIZE=16

## Log Sampling — Chimeward Notifier

The notifier emits roughly 40k log lines per minute, so we sample at 1% for INFO and keep all WARN and above. Sampled lines are batched and written to the audit store every 30 seconds. To verify sampled batches are landing, query the audit store using the connection string below.

replica DSN, kajep-yahag: mssql://praok_svc:iF@db-8d68.plorvaio.local:5432/eliion

## Brightvale Series Pricing — Managers Only

List pricing for the Brightvale product line holds at current tiers through the next two quarters. Sales leads may apply up to 8% discretionary discount on annual commitments; anything beyond requires sign-off from Dana Kerrow. Volume bands remain unchanged for the Brightvale Core and Plus tiers. Before quoting enterprise deals, note the following.

management briefing: Project Ulavan slips by two quarters because of the staffing delay.